The Historical Carnival of Ivrea is one of the most famous Italian events, dating back to the Middle Ages. The pageant of historical figures re-enacts a local legend, according to which Violetta, a miller’s daughter, killed the baron who wanted to claim the ius primae noctis, thus triggering a revolt in the city. The famous Battle of the Oranges held each year recreates the uprising of the people against the feudal lord.
